Decluttering Your Living Room for Safety & Style

A clear floor is a safe floor. As we plan for long-term independence at home, one of the most impactful changes we can make is creating unobstructed pathways through our living spaces. Every item left on the floor, from a stack of books to a stray remote control, presents a potential risk for a fall.

A storage ottoman addresses this directly by providing a designated, hidden home for everyday items. It’s a dual-purpose tool that works smarter, not harder. Instead of adding more shelving or bins that can make a room feel crowded, an ottoman consolidates seating, storage, and even a surface for a tray of drinks into one functional footprint. This isn’t about sterile minimalism; it’s about strategic organization that makes your home work better for you.

Article Ceni Ottoman: Modern Design on Solid Legs

The design of an ottoman’s base is more important than you might think. The Article Ceni ottoman features a clean, modern design elevated on solid wood legs. This elevation serves several practical purposes in a home designed for aging in place.

First, the space underneath makes cleaning much easier, as you can get a vacuum or mop underneath without moving the entire piece. Second, and more critically for long-term planning, that clearance can accommodate the footrests of a wheelchair or the base of a walker, ensuring better accessibility. Furniture on legs also creates an illusion of more space, making a room feel open and less cluttered—a key principle of universal design.

Kelly Clarkson Home Louise: Lightweight Lift-Off Lid

How you access the storage in your ottoman is a key detail. Many ottomans feature heavy, hinged lids that can be awkward to hold open while you search inside. Worse, a heavy lid could accidentally slam shut. The Louise ottoman from the Kelly Clarkson Home collection often features a simple, lightweight lift-off lid.

This design is inherently safer and easier to use. There are no hinges to pinch fingers, and the lid can be removed completely and set aside for effortless access. For anyone, regardless of age or strength, this simple mechanical difference makes the storage feature far more practical for frequent, everyday use. It’s a small detail that reflects a thoughtful, user-centric design.

Choosing the Right Ottoman for Long-Term Comfort

Selecting the right storage ottoman is a strategic decision that balances aesthetics with forward-thinking practicality. As you evaluate your options, consider these key factors to ensure you choose a piece that will serve you well for years to come.

Your decision-making framework should include:

  • Stability and Construction: Does it have a solid internal frame and sturdy legs? Can it safely be used as an extra seat or for momentary support? Prioritize a firm, flat top over a plush, overstuffed one.
  • Lid Mechanism: Is the lid easy and safe to operate? A lightweight, fully removable lid is often a more accessible choice than a heavy, hinged one.
  • Material and Maintenance: Is the fabric or material durable and easy to clean? Low-maintenance surfaces reduce physical effort and keep your furniture looking its best.
  • Height and Scale: Is the ottoman’s height compatible with your existing sofa for comfortable leg-resting? Does its overall size fit your room without impeding traffic flow?

Ultimately, the goal is to find a piece that seamlessly integrates into your life. It should reduce clutter, enhance safety, and reflect your personal style without creating new challenges. This single piece of furniture can be a powerful tool in creating a home that is truly designed for living.
